省选完挂记
内容
完挂
暴力没打全,正解全写挂,完美滚粗。
[hermit auto=”0″ loop=”0″ unexpand=”0″ fullheight=”0″]netease_songs#:27906320[/hermit]
Day0
上午8点到的学校,和博弈达成了住一个屋的共识。上午没大写东西,随便看了看以前的板子。
大概1点出发去济南,在车上搓了一路的ls, 得到了DP的指导
到了济南正好赶上下班高峰期,直接堵死。原来3h能到拖到了5h。
住在loli所说的四星级旅馆。
晚上loli的意思是直接在宾馆里吃了,但是一斤鱼188,我们一堆高一的去了KFC。走了1KM多才到。
博弈不知道迷上了什么剧,疯狂追剧。晚上敲了个LCT和最大流。
Day1
早上吃了早饭就去了山师大。大概走个10min就到了。
那里的键盘真是难用到爆,空格键跟个跷跷板似的。
我随便敲了个对拍就发题了。
先随便看了一遍题:
T1直接暴力三十吧。
T2好像是原题啊:染色。
T3暴力吧。
当时直接开始码。T1打了个斐波那契表,大概30min过了样例。但是当时以为就直接30了,没有考虑到T=1000
。。直接去肝T2了。
T2仔细看了一眼,和染色不一样啊,胡乱推了推没想出来第二种操作。但是想出了第三种操作的 $O(nlongn)$ 的瞎搞做法。这样暴力直接用桶肝第二种操作,能过30啊。
脑子一热,就直接开始肝链剖,码完加上拍完调试完以后就只剩1h了。
又码了30min的T3暴力,正想打上文件交上,突然发现了T1只有10分。当时直接慌了,疯狂推出了某种诡异的矩乘优化预处理,但是没时间打了。最后知道了DP就是写的这个
最后交上了10+30+20的程序。这样的话,假如暴力打满是30+10+20,所以我认真做了5h的题直接和随便打的暴力一个分。当然链剖会直接爆栈,还不知道为什么T3找不到我的程序。sb工作人
最后得分10+10+0=20。
心态爆炸,和DP颓了一下午,终于心情好点了,晚上用QQ红包叫的外卖,比垃圾FKC好多了。
晚上忘带房卡,叫了某工作人员开的门,敲了个SA的板子,睡觉了。博弈还在追剧
Day2
吃完早饭,冲向考场,打算好好考。
敲了个Dinic就发题了。
T1:暴力有10分啊,20分是裸地最大费用最大流啊。
T2:不可做,10分暴力状压状态吧。
T3:噫又是原题:方差
首先打了个T1暴力和费用流拍了起来,大概用了1h。
然后开始昏天暗地的肝T3。2h敲完后随便写了个暴力拍了一下,直接崩成狗。改了大概1h后,错误大概都是除0崩的错误了,把两个代码和了一下,又随便敲了一下T2,过了样例。
期望得分30+10+70=110
最后知道了线段树要开long double
,直接崩掉50分,T2暴力开小了数组,崩掉10分,最后得分30+0+20=50
最后和DP在某垃圾面馆吃了面,就回家了。
总结
客观的看整场比赛,该打好的暴力都没打,因为追求虚无缥缈的正解,花费了太多的时间。
我现在的水平就不应该是上来就想太高分的水平,把暴力打好,扎扎实实走好每一步,肯定是能进二轮的,整个考试策略就是错误的。
今天名单下来了,差3名进二轮,其实也是在意料之中,其实以现在我的水平,进了二轮也是划水,还不如老老实实学学文化课,暑假好好学,不要整天浪费时间在虚无缥缈的东西上,扎扎实实学好基础算法数据结构,争取更好的结果。
反观高一这一年,还是太颓废了,老是在一些无用的东西上浪费时间。省选前,老是想学一些高级的东西,但以自己的水平,还是学不懂的,无论是在水题还是在太难的题上都是浪费时间,正如大哥省选前说的:“感觉你最近太颓废了。”。
要好好巩固已经学习过的算法数据结构,做一些适用于自己水平的题,其实省选并没有用到太多没学过的算法,只是我做题太少了,没有看出这种算法所对应的题目。这大概就是所谓的板子选手
。
还有一年的时间可以努力,一定要好好争取时间。
引用某金牌爷的话
毕竟大家都是努力后的人,也就不在乎什么名次好了。
所谓考试就是站在一些奇奇怪怪的角度,去看你在路上走了多远,但事实上你走了多远,欣赏到多少美丽的沿途的风景,也只有自己知道了。
2018 bless all
upd 5-10
奇怪的续命技巧